Manchester United eye Juventus midfielder as Aston Villa joins race
Manchester United are showing interest in this Serie A midfielder, and the question is what will he bring to Old Trafford? The Red Devils have been linked with the Dutch talent as the summer window opens.
Calciomercato reported that Manchester United are actively pursuing Juventus midfielder Teun Koopmeiners this summer. It has also been mentioned that the Red Devils would have to rival Aston Villa in the race to sign the Dutch talent.
Koopmeiners enjoyed a solid campaign in Italian football, playing 45 matches for Juve last season. He netted two goals and recorded one assist across multiple competitions, establishing himself as one of the most reliable central midfielders in Serie A.
The 28‑year‑old’s contract with the Turin club runs out in the summer of 2029, a detail that could make it difficult for Manchester United to acquire him cheaply later in the year. This long‑term deal adds urgency to the Red Devils’ pursuit.
The Dutch midfielder is a good tackler who senses danger well, making crucial interceptions in the middle of the park. He also clears his lines when needed, distributes the ball accurately, and can chip in with occasional goals and assists.
Primarily a defensive midfielder, Koopmeiners can also operate as a centre‑back or in a number ten role if required. However, there are question marks over whether he can adapt to the physical demands and high intensity of Premier League football.
If signed, he would bring more quality and depth to Michael Carrick’s midfield department at Manchester United. At 28, he is in his prime and could serve as a suitable replacement for Casemiro, challenging for regular first‑team football at Old Trafford next season.
